Council accepts first-quarter financial report; staff highlights capital and staffing updates
Summary
Council received and accepted the city's first quarterly financial report for the fiscal year, covering major funds, staffing changes, capital projects, demolition of substandard structures, and anticipated revenue and expenditure variances.
The Tyler City Council accepted the city’s first quarterly financial report for the fiscal year after staff summarized highlights across major funds, staffing actions, and capital projects.
